ããTHE Bulleen Boomers are
expected to announce these days that they have re-signed star
players Liz Cambage and Rachel Jarry for the subsequent WNBL
season. ããCambage will be the
reigning Women's National Basketball League's most useful player
and along with Jarry played a pivotal function in assisting the
Boomers to their initial WNBL championship this past season.
ããEach Cambage and Jarry
publicly committed to the Boomers quickly following the
championship, even though the club has lost Opals star Jenna O'Hea,
who signed with cross-town rivals Dandenong Rangers.
ããThe Boomers are believed to
be close to finalising their roster and could announce additional
signings today. ããOpals
forward Hollie Grima Florance has also been linked to the Boomers
but is however to confirm her plans for the subsequent WNBL season.
ããGrima Florance is presently
playing with Eltham in the Large V State Championship competitors.
ããCambage and Jarry were
drafted by WNBA clubs earlier this year, with Cambage going number
two to the Tulsa Shock and Jarry going at choose 18 towards the
Atlanta Dream before her draft rights had been traded towards the
Minnesota Lynx. ããJarry chose
to stay in Australia this year and move to the WNBA following the
